August 5

Dedication of the Basilica of Santa María Maggiore

This is how the breviary told, until the last liturgical reform, the history of this festival: In the time of Pope Liberius, in the middle of the 4th century, a noble and very rich family lived in Rome.

So rich that, no matter how many alms they gave to the poor as exemplary Christians, they never ran out. One day the two spouses went to the Virgin Mary, begging her to inspire them with the way most pleasing to them and their Son, to make use of their wealth. The Virgin came to the aid of Juan Patricio and his wife while they were sleeping. In dreams, and separately, the Virgin Mary appeared to them, telling them that it was her desire that they build a temple in her honor in the place that She indicated to them. They had to build it on Mount Esquiline and in that part where it was all covered in snow. The two husbands went to Pope Liberius to tell him about the vision. The Pope had also had the same vision as them. The Supreme Pontiff organizes a Procession and everyone goes singing hymns to the Lord and his Mother the Virgin Mary towards the indicated place. When they get there, everyone is amazed when they contemplate those wonders. A large piece of mountain appeared, bounded by fresh, white snow. The people sing with joy and there, in the heart of Rome, they build a magnificent Basilica in honor of Saint Mary, which they would dedicate four years later. This is how the devotion to Our Lady of Las Nieves, Santa María del Pesebre or Santa María la Mayor, Basilica Liberiana, etc. arises. what is it called. The legend of this story does not appear until very late. The truth is that it has influenced true history and has made this great Basilica one of the four largest in Rome and one of the most beautiful and most visited in Christendom. The devotion of the Roman people to the Virgin is encouraged, above all, by this sumptuous temple dedicated to the Mother of God and where the largest part of the Crib of Bethlehem is preserved and, on Christmas Eve, the Pope, who is at the same time the Bishop of Rome, usually celebrates the Eucharist in this Basilica. It is considered the oldest Church in the West, dedicated to the Virgin Mary.
